Russian hot springs point to rocky origins for life

Posted on 13 Feb 2012 in Chemistry, Earth Science, Evolution, Featured, Journalism, Life

Where on Earth is the cradle of life? The widespread view is that life began in the oceans, in the water that surrounds deep-sea hydrothermal vents. But that story is being challenged by new evidence that life began on land, which is deepening a rift between origin-of-life biologists. Image: Anna S. Karyagina

